https://callback.58.com/antibot/verifycode?serialId=896e20d0d62700b1bc2bd6f3948cf1c7_b012c9d26a0e4f4a814735f411d57a48&code=100&sign=9dce621d1569312fa7041afbffaa93f8&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fchengdu.anjuke.com%2Fsale%2Fwenjiang%2Fa15226-b62-d20-l2-m11097-o5-t21-z5-fl2